Springfield City Jail is a holding office for confining individuals and introducing them to the courts. The Springfield City Jail is a 67-bed jail, with both confinement cells and holding cells. The Springfield City Jail is run and overseen by a group of individuals partitioned into shifts for the day.

The principal reason for the Springfield City Jail is to guarantee individuals are ensured and introduced to courts.

More often than not, individuals befuddle between Springfield City Jail and Lane County jail. Springfield City Jail just obliges Springfield’s city while region jail considers the whole province.

Inmate Search

The Springfield City Jail sole design is just to hold these wrongdoers until they can head out to their more lasting home in the regional office.

So, many of these prisoners are rescued not long after being brought to the Springfield City Jail. The Springfield City Jail right now doesn’t have the labor to deal with an information base that will change regularly.

If you need data on a prisoner in the Springfield City Jail, your solitary alternative is to call the Springfield City Jail at 541-726-3714.

Sending A Mail/Package

The Springfield City Jail doesn’t acknowledge mail or bundles to the guilty parties. You may feel that is somewhat unforgiving, however with the offender list regularly changing, when your letter arrives at the detention center, they will get released, or they will get shipped off another detention center.

In that possibility that you do send something to a wrongdoer in the Springfield City Jail, it will get rejected once it gets to the Springfield City Jail. 

Sending Money

The Springfield City Jail gives all that you can consider to their wrongdoers. Wrongdoers in the Springfield City Jail needn’t bother with such assets or cash when they are in Springfield City Jail.

When the guilty parties go on to their next office, at that point, there might be a requirement for reserves. Be that as it may, as long as they are in the Springfield City Jail, they will get very much dealt with.

Phone Calls

The Springfield City Jail will give every wrongdoer who experiences the booking and confirmation measure one free call home. This will be the primary call that the prisoner will get that won’t cost you any cash.

From that point onward, all calls are gathered calls and will cost you cash for tolerating them.

Visitation

Since more often than not, a wrongdoer in the Springfield City Jail isn’t in the office for such a significant period; appearance is disallowed.

Nonetheless, there will be lawyers and direction visits accessible.
You can also know more about visitations in the Springfield City Jail by calling 541-726-3714.
